Good lap swimming shorts; thick material that allows for modesty
My husband and I swim 3x/week, and he goes through suits about 3 times faster than I do because most are thin and they become see-through fairly quickly. He also has trouble with them getting baggy. These trunks have held up really well so far. He likes the thicker material; we swim for fitness, not competition, so the drag isn't an issue. They're matte black, and lined really well through the crotch, which he likes a lot (it also looks better than the thin, shiny ones that show everything). These have maintained their fit and opacity really well thus far, and at a price point far lower than others he bought at sporting goods stores (for $50+). He also likes the length on these, as they're not as long as some. We're very happy with this purchase so far (it has been a couple of months, and we still can't see light through them). He ordered the black with grey trim.

Ordered the Mens Lrg/34 in black. I won't be swimming in them, but more for gym workout, biking, running, hiking.To get to the key points about the product.- Large 34 is perfect if you normally wear 32-33 pants.- Inseam for the Lrg/34 is 10" (I know many ask about this)- Has wide and thick waist band w/ flat shoelace type drawstrings embedded.- On the "protective" extra lining most ask about. There are none around the crotch area, but rather the entire shorts is double lined. Seriously. Its quite heavy duty and dense in feeling. Even if you stretch it, its not see through like typical compression shorts.- Stitching is really nice.- Well worth the price and I think its much better than the expensive Speedo's equivalent (which I have also)I am really pleased with this. I may order another if all is well after a few uses and wash cycles.

Great value
I bought these about 6 mths ago, swim laps in them three times a week, and they have not faded nor lost their 'stretchiness.' They cling to your body but they are comfortable. After each swim, I give them a good rinse, and once a week wash them with regular laundry. They still look new. I think that they're a great value for the money.I'm 6', 188 lbs, wear a waist size 34 in Levi's, and I ordered the trunks in size M. They fit just fine.Follow-up: I bought another pair, not because the first is worn out, but just for convenience. I've worn my first pair now for about a year, using them 3-4 times per week. They are still just fine -- haven't faded, haven't lost stretchiness, and no seam stretching or damage. They truly are a very, very good product and an exceptional value.

Decent suit, but be aware material is very thick
Overall this was a decent suit for the price. The material is very "thick", which has pros and cons. The pro is that they are more modest than typical spandex or lycra, which is nice if you prefer not to have an obvious outline of certain parts of your anatomy. And I guess the thickness probably helps with durability. The con is that they are very slow - the drag from the material is rather noticeable.After about a year of usage, the fit really started to deteriorate - sagging and losing cling. I now have to tie them super tight just to keep them from falling down when I push off the wall.
